Lost Luggage? A Different Kind of Quest

QuickTip: A short pause boosts comprehension.Help reference icon

If your luggage decided to explore Melbourne on its own, fret not! Airlines handle lost luggage, so contact your airline directly to report the missing suitcase. They'll have their own procedures to get your clothes and toiletries back on track.

Frequently Asked Questions

FAQs: Lost Property Edition

  • How long do they keep lost items? Unclaimed items are typically held for three months. But hey, the sooner you report it, the sooner you'll be reunited with your lost treasure.
  • What if I find someone else's lost item? You goody two-shoes! Hand it in to the nearest information desk or security personnel. Someone out there is probably missing it dearly.
  • Can I track my lost item online? Unfortunately, there's no real-time tracking system for lost items at Melbourne Airport. But keep an eye on your email for updates.
  • Do I need proof of ownership to claim my lost item? Yep, bringing some ID (like a driver's license) that proves the item belongs to you will smoothen the process.
  • Is there a fee for retrieving a lost item? Nope! Reuniting you with your lost belongings is their mission (and maybe they secretly enjoy the heartwarming reunions).
